New York City office of a BCG Attorney Search Top Ranked Law Firm seeks mid-level associate attorney with 4+ years of experience working in a matrimonial firm. The candidate will communicate with other attorneys and paralegals to effectively move through the civil litigation process. Will help solve divorce and family issues for clients through analyzing the situation, understanding their needs, and creating a strategic plan of action. Handle the division of marital assets during divorce proceedings as needed. Advise and advocate for clients in child custody disputes. Keep client files properly organized and up to date. Represent clients in court proceedings as needed. Draft pleadings, motions, contracts, marital settlement agreements, divorce judgments, support orders, and other orders for a high volume of cases. Draft and/or edit motions, affidavits, pleadings, legal arguments, testimony, and trial briefs. Hearing Preparation, client representation. Case consultation and strategizing with clients. Communication with opposing parties, court, and others. Perform case law research to identify and apply relevant judicial decisions, statutes, legal articles, codes, and other pertinent material. Investigate the facts of a case. Review and monitor new and updated laws and regulations. Edit and approve substantive correspondence. Advising clients on the development of their case objectives. Ensuring transparency of the firm's casework. Answering clients' questions in a timely fashion. Keeping clients aware of their case status to their satisfaction. Abiding by the ethical rules of the profession. Thorough and timely counseling clients on settlement versus contesting issues. Promoting an excellent client experience. Perform other tasks as assigned by Senior Attorney. Should have technical training or knowledge: Basic business software (MS Office Suite), Email client software, Dropbox software, cloud service, eFax, case management software, Legal research software (Westlaw, Lexis), and other computer and telephone technology. Thorough knowledge of legal principles and practices is essential. Thorough knowledge of legal research techniques is needed. Should have a thorough knowledge of legal terminology. In-depth knowledge of state laws and regulations is needed. Must be admitted to practice law in New York and have satisfactory standing with the State Bar. Should have Juris Doctorate degree from ABA law school. Excellent communication and negotiation skills, especially in highly stressful and emotional situations essential.
